Understanding ALCOA+ Principles
ALCOA+ is a widely adopted acronym that signifies Attributable, Legible, Contemporaneous, Original, Accurate, and encompasses additional principles such as Complete, Consistent, Enduring, and Available. Each component of ALCOA+ is critical for ensuring data integrity across
- Attributable: Data should be traceable to a specific individual who is responsible for its creation and modification.
- Legible: Data must be easily readable and understandable to all stakeholders.
- Contemporaneous: Data should be recorded at the time it is generated or observed.
- Original: The original records must be preserved; photocopies and facsimiles are not acceptable.
- Accurate: Data must reflect the true observations and measurements without any alterations.
- Complete: All data should be recorded, including all relevant details.
- Consistent: Data should be recorded following a consistent procedure across different instances.
- Enduring: Records should maintain their integrity over time and remain uncorrupted.
- Available: Data must be readily accessible to authorized individuals in a timely manner.

Common Data Integrity Failures in India
Several documented instances highlight data integrity failures within the Indian pharmaceutical sector. These failures often result from inadequate training, lack of awareness, and insufficient systems for audit trail management. Here are some of the key issues encountered:
- Inconsistent Data Entry: Forms filled out manually often result in inconsistent data entries due to human error, typographical errors, or lack of adherence to standard operating procedures (SOPs).
- Manipulation of Records: Instances of unauthorized changes to electronic records without proper documentation have been observed, resulting in regulatory breaches.
- Inadequate Audit Trails: Failure to maintain comprehensive audit trails that capture modifications and access to data is a significant issue.
- Electronic Signature Concerns: Issues regarding the authenticity and management of electronic signatures, particularly in connection to compliance with 21 CFR Part 11, continue to pose challenges.
- Data Backup Inadequacies: Ineffective data backup policies can lead to loss of critical data, impacting compliance and quality assurance.
Case Study 1: Inconsistent Data Entry
One major pharmaceutical company faced a significant issue when audit observations revealed that data entries in laboratory notebooks did not match those recorded in electronic systems. The variability was traced back to the manual entry process, leading to inconsistencies that raised concerns about data integrity.
Corrective Actions Implemented
- Conducted comprehensive training sessions for personnel on the importance of accurate data entry and adherence to ALCOA+ principles.
- Implemented an automated data capture system, where possible, to minimize human error and ensure consistency.
- Regular internal audits were initiated to review data entries against electronic records to ensure alignment.
Case Study 2: Manipulation of Records
A second case highlighted a scenario where an employee altered raw data entries in an electronic system without authorization. This manipulation was discovered during an internal investigation aimed at reviewing data integrity protocols.
Corrective Actions Implemented
- Strengthened access controls to ensure that only authorized personnel could alter electronic records.
- Established a clear policy for documenting changes to records, including reasons for modifications, and ensured proper training on this policy.
- Incorporated a whistle-blower policy allowing employees to anonymously report instances of data tampering.
Case Study 3: Inadequate Audit Trails
Another organization faced regulatory citations due to inadequate audit trails in their electronic data systems. The audit trails failed to capture necessary changes, which prompted concerns about the authenticity and reliability of the data.
Corrective Actions Implemented
- Upgraded data management systems to ensure robust audit trail capabilities that log all user activity, including changes, deletions, and access.
- Conducted regular reviews of audit trails as part of the internal quality assurance process to ensure compliance.
- Established a routine for auditing audit trails to identify any discrepancies or suspicious activities.
Best Practices for Ensuring Data Integrity
To mitigate risks associated with data integrity failures, organizations should consider adopting the following best practices:
- Regular Training: Provide ongoing training for all employees on data integrity, ALCOA+ principles, and regulatory compliance.
- Documented Procedures: Develop and maintain well-documented SOPs that outline the processes for data management, including data entry, modification, and retention.
- Systematic Validation: Perform comprehensive validation of systems used for data capture and retention to ensure compliance with both Schedule M and international standards.
- Review and Revise Policies: Regularly review data integrity policies and practices to adapt to new regulations and technological advancements.
- Employ Robust Backup Solutions: Establish a data backup policy that ensures the availability and integrity of data, including routine testing of backup and recovery processes.
Integrating Electronic Records with Global Standards
In light of aligning with global regulators like the US FDA and EMA, it is crucial for Indian pharmaceutical companies to integrate electronic records management systems that comply with worldwide standards such as 21 CFR Part 11. This integration includes:
- Ensuring that electronic signatures are secure, unique to each user, and offer non-repudiation.
- Implementing systems that allow for electronic records to be considered equivalent to paper records, with the same level of legal enforceability.
- Maintaining the integrity of data when migrating from manual to electronic formats, ensuring compliance with data integrity principles throughout the process.
